Past Simple- Speaking cards
Students play in pairs or groups. Each student takes a card and completes the sentence with the verb in the past. If it is correct , they keep the card. The student with more cards wins. Have fun.

Back to school BINGO
great activity when you come back from half term holidays. Pupils choose actions, fill in their grid and ask each others questions(did you...?)If the answer is "yes, I did", they can write the name of their friend in the grid.
